Matt Love (bass, guitar, vocals), Leo B (keyboards, samples, vocals) met while
working as waiters in a Brazilian Steakhouse in our nations capital.
Over time they discovered that they had a remarkable number of things
in common - they were all supporting members in bands where they were
supporting talented and charismatic, but stubbornly indepentent
leaders. Their creative lives were charactorized by periods of
frenetic creative activity, and stetches of inactivity.
They found it ironic in the extreme that they were working as waiters
until they could become rawk stars - but they were waiters in their
creative lives as well. Over a steaming platter of steaks they were
serving to a congressional delegation, they decided to form their own
band, and use it as a vehicle to display their unique talents. They
named themselves the Waiters so that they would never forget why they
formed this band.
